class ShardedStateLoader(BaseModelLoader):
    """
    Model loader that directly loads each worker's model state dict, which
    enables a fast load path for large tensor-parallel models where each worker
    only needs to read its own shard rather than the entire checkpoint. See
430
    `examples/save_sharded_state.py` for creating a sharded checkpoint.
431
432
433
434
435
436
437
438
439
440
441
442
443
444
445
446
447
448
449
450
451
452
453
454
455
456
457
458
459
460
461
462
463
464
465
466
467
468
469
470
471
472
473
474
475
476
477
478
479
    """

    DEFAULT_PATTERN = "model-rank-{rank}-part-{part}.safetensors"

    def __init__(self, load_config: LoadConfig):
        super().__init__(load_config)
        extra_config = ({} if load_config.model_loader_extra_config is None
                        else load_config.model_loader_extra_config.copy())
        self.pattern = extra_config.pop("pattern", self.DEFAULT_PATTERN)
        if extra_config:
            raise ValueError(f"Unexpected extra config keys for load format "
                             f"{load_config.load_format}: "
                             f"{load_config.model_loader_extra_config.keys()}")

    @staticmethod
    def _filter_subtensors(
            tensors: Dict[str, torch.Tensor]) -> Dict[str, torch.Tensor]:
        """
        Filter out all tensors that share the same memory or a subset of the
        memory of another tensor.
        """
        same_storage_groups = collections.defaultdict(list)
        for key, tensor in tensors.items():
            if tensor.numel():
                ptr = tensor.untyped_storage().data_ptr()
                same_storage_groups[tensor.device, ptr].append((key, tensor))

        def get_end_ptr(tensor: torch.Tensor) -> int:
            return tensor.view(-1)[-1].data_ptr() + tensor.element_size()

        result = {}
        for group in same_storage_groups.values():
            for k, t in group:
                a, b = t.data_ptr(), get_end_ptr(t)
                for k2, t2 in group:
                    if not t2.is_contiguous():
                        continue
                    a2, b2 = t2.data_ptr(), get_end_ptr(t2)
                    if a < a2 or b2 < b:
                        continue
                    if a2 < a or b < b2 or not t.is_contiguous():
                        break  # t2 covers strictly more memory than t.
                    if k2 < k:
                        # Same tensors, keep the one with the smaller key.
                        break
                else:
                    result[k] = t
        return result

class BitsAndBytesModelLoader(BaseModelLoader):
    """Model loader to load model weights with BitAndBytes quantization."""

    default_target_modules = [
        "gate_proj", "down_proj", "up_proj", "q_proj", "k_proj", "v_proj",
        "o_proj"
    ]

    possible_config_file_names = ["adapter_config.json"]

    def __init__(self, load_config: LoadConfig):
        super().__init__(load_config)

        # we don't need to quantize the whole model, only the target modules
        # that are specified in the adapter config file. If the adapter config
        # file is not provided, we will quantize the default modules.
        if (not load_config.model_loader_extra_config
                or "qlora_adapter_name_or_path"
                not in load_config.model_loader_extra_config):
            self.target_modules = self.default_target_modules
            return

        qlora_adapter = load_config.model_loader_extra_config[
            "qlora_adapter_name_or_path"]

        config_file_path = self._get_config_file(qlora_adapter)

        with open(config_file_path, "r") as f:
            config = json.load(f)
            self.target_modules = config["target_modules"]

    def _get_config_file(self, qlora_adapter: str) -> str:
        is_local = os.path.isdir(qlora_adapter)
        config_file_path = None
        if is_local:
            for file in self.possible_config_file_names:
                config_file_path = os.path.join(qlora_adapter, file)
                if os.path.exists(config_file_path):
                    break
        else:
            hf_api = HfApi()
            repo_files = hf_api.list_repo_files(repo_id=qlora_adapter)
            for file in self.possible_config_file_names:
                if file in repo_files:
                    config_file_path = hf_hub_download(repo_id=qlora_adapter,
                                                       filename=file)
                    break

        if not config_file_path:
            raise ValueError(
                f"Cannot find adapter config file in {qlora_adapter}")

        return config_file_path

    def _get_weight_files(
            self,
            model_name_or_path: str,
            allowed_patterns: List[str],
            revision: Optional[str] = None) -> Tuple[List[str], str]:
        """Retrieve weight files. Download the files if necessary. 
        
        Return the weight files and the file pattern."""
        is_local = os.path.isdir(model_name_or_path)

        if is_local:
            for pattern in allowed_patterns:
                weight_files = glob.glob(
                    os.path.join(model_name_or_path, pattern))
                if weight_files:
                    return weight_files, pattern
        else:
            hf_api = HfApi()
            repo_files = hf_api.list_repo_files(repo_id=model_name_or_path)
            for pattern in allowed_patterns:
                matching_files = fnmatch.filter(repo_files, pattern)
                if matching_files:
                    hf_folder = download_weights_from_hf(
                        model_name_or_path, self.load_config.download_dir,
                        [pattern], revision)
                    return glob.glob(os.path.join(hf_folder, pattern)), pattern

        raise RuntimeError(
            f"No model weights found in: `{model_name_or_path}`")

    def _prepare_weights(self, model_name_or_path: str,
                         revision: Optional[str]) -> Tuple[List[str], bool]:
        """Prepare weight files for the model."""

        allowed_patterns = ["*.safetensors", "*.bin", "*.pt"]

        hf_weights_files, matched_pattern = self._get_weight_files(
            model_name_or_path, allowed_patterns, revision)

        if matched_pattern != "*.safetensors":
            hf_weights_files = filter_files_not_needed_for_inference(
                hf_weights_files)

        if len(hf_weights_files) == 0:
            raise RuntimeError(
                f"Cannot find any model weights with `{model_name_or_path}`")

        return hf_weights_files, matched_pattern == "*.safetensors"

    def _get_quantized_weights_iterator(
        self, model_name_or_path: str, revision: Optional[str]
    ) -> Tuple[Generator[Tuple[str, torch.Tensor], None, None], Dict[str,
                                                                     Any]]:
        """Get an iterator to the model weights with bitsandbytes quantization,
        as well as the quantization state dictionary."""

        # only load the bitsandbytes module when needed
        try:
            import bitsandbytes
            if bitsandbytes.__version__ < "0.42.0":
                raise ImportError("bitsandbytes version is wrong. Please "
                                  "install bitsandbytes>=0.42.0.")
            from bitsandbytes.functional import quantize_4bit
        except ImportError as err:
            raise ImportError("Please install bitsandbytes>=0.42.0 via "
                              "`pip install bitsandbytes>=0.42.0` to use "
                              "bitsandbytes quantizer.") from err

        hf_weights_files, use_safetensors = self._prepare_weights(
            model_name_or_path, revision)

        quant_state_dict = {}
        if use_safetensors:
            weight_iterator = safetensors_weights_iterator(hf_weights_files)
        else:
            weight_iterator = pt_weights_iterator(hf_weights_files)

        def generator():
            for weight_name, weight_tensor in weight_iterator:
                if any(target_module in weight_name
                       for target_module in self.target_modules):
                    weight_name = weight_name.replace(".weight", ".qweight")
                    #  bitsandbytes requires data in GPU
                    loaded_weight = weight_tensor.cuda().data
                    with set_default_torch_dtype(torch.float32):
                        processed_weight, quant_state = quantize_4bit(
                            loaded_weight,
                            compress_statistics=True,
                            quant_type="nf4")

                    quant_state_dict[weight_name] = quant_state
                else:
                    processed_weight = weight_tensor

                yield weight_name, processed_weight

        return generator(), quant_state_dict

    def _load_weights(self, model_config: ModelConfig,
                      model: nn.Module) -> None:
        if not hasattr(model, 'load_weights'):
            raise AttributeError(
                "The required method 'load_weights' is not defined in class"
                f" {type(self).__name__}.")

        if not hasattr(model, 'bitsandbytes_stacked_params_mapping'):
            raise AttributeError(
                f"Model {type(self).__name__} does not support BitsAndBytes "
                "quantization yet.")

        logger.info("Loading weights with BitsAndBytes quantization. "
                    " May take a while ...")

        qweight_iterator, quant_state_dict = (
            self._get_quantized_weights_iterator(model_config.model,
                                                 model_config.revision))

        model.load_weights(qweight_iterator)

        param_dict = dict(model.named_parameters())
        stacked_quant_state_dict: Dict[str, Dict[int, Any]] = {}
        for quant_param_name in quant_state_dict:
            non_stacked_param_name = quant_param_name

            shard_index = 0
            for shard_name, (
                    weight_name, index
            ) in model.bitsandbytes_stacked_params_mapping.items():
                if shard_name in quant_param_name:
                    shard_index = index
                    quant_param_name = quant_param_name.replace(
                        shard_name, weight_name)
                    break

            if quant_param_name not in param_dict:
                raise ValueError(
                    f"Parameter {quant_param_name} not found in the model.")

            if quant_param_name not in stacked_quant_state_dict:
                stacked_quant_state_dict[quant_param_name] = {}

            stacked_quant_state_dict[quant_param_name][shard_index] = (
                quant_state_dict[non_stacked_param_name])

        # save quant_states and offsets as the attributes of the parameters
        for param_name, param in param_dict.items():
            if param_name in stacked_quant_state_dict:
                quant_states = stacked_quant_state_dict[param_name]
                set_weight_attrs(param, {"bnb_quant_state": quant_states})

                pack_ratio = getattr(param, "pack_factor", -1)
                if pack_ratio == -1:
                    raise ValueError(
                        f"pack_factor not set for parameter {param_name}.")

                num_elements = [0] * len(quant_states)
                for seq, quant_state in enumerate(quant_states.items()):
                    num_elements[seq] = math.prod(
                        quant_state[1].shape) // pack_ratio

                offsets = np.concatenate(([0], np.cumsum(num_elements)))
                set_weight_attrs(param, {"bnb_shard_offsets": offsets})

    def load_model(self, *, model_config: ModelConfig,
                   device_config: DeviceConfig,
                   lora_config: Optional[LoRAConfig],
                   vision_language_config: Optional[VisionLanguageConfig],
                   parallel_config: ParallelConfig,
                   scheduler_config: SchedulerConfig,
                   cache_config: CacheConfig) -> nn.Module:
        with set_default_torch_dtype(model_config.dtype):
            with torch.device(device_config.device):
                model = _initialize_model(model_config, self.load_config,
                                          lora_config, vision_language_config,
                                          cache_config)

                self._load_weights(model_config, model)

        return model.eval()
